《单片机技术应用与系统开发》教学大纲
(V10)课程名称:《单片机技术应用与系统开发》适用专业:计算机应用专业(嵌入式方向)、电子类专业、自动化专业总学时:128学时先修课程:《计算机电路基础》或者《电子技术》《Portel电路设计》、后续课程:《单片机应用系统开发实战》一、课程简介:
这部分根据各专业的具体情况而定二、教学要求:
1、教学原则:本课程以培养学生应用能力为宗旨,突出基础知识的掌握和实践技能的训练;注重实验室与工程开发的统一,通过一系列实训和产品设计,在实践中学习单片机的相关知识及单片机软硬件设计技术,最终达到使学生具备单片机应用系统开发的基本能力,为后续的单片机应用系统开发实战打下坚实的基础。2、教学方法:“教、学、做”一体化。教师主要讲解完成每个任务的相关知识,学生在掌据了相关知识后学习本任务设计的技巧,并在教师的指导下完成本任务的硬件设计和软件设计工作。在完成任务的过程中建议采取分组教学、学生讨论、教师指导的方式进行。在实践的过程中,对于基础比较差的学生或者是动手能力较弱的学生,建议实训在MFSC2实训平台上进行,对于动手能力比较强的学生,建议实训在MFSC1型平台上进行。如果无实训平台,实训时可以用面包板或者多功能电路板按教材中所介绍的电路进行硬件电路搭建。对于扩展实践,建议以小组为单位让学生独立完成软硬设计工作。3、使用教材及主要参考书:教材:《单片机技术应用与系统开发》李文华主要参考书:《单片机初级教程》4、学生学习要求:
1
大连理工大学出版北京航空航天大学出版社
张俊谟张迎亲李朝青
《单片机原理及接口技术》
北京航空航天大学出版社
f1、学生能够独立地完成各任务的设计,并能举一反三。2、掌握各个实例的设计思路和实现步骤。3、掌握单片机的应用特性,包括单片机的最小系统、并口、串口、定时计数器、中断等。4、掌握单片机应用系统的扩展方法,重点是掌握串行扩展的方法。5、掌握单片机应用系统的设计方法,重点是掌握监控程序的设计方法。三、学时分配表:教学内容单片机应用系统入门实践开关量输入显示跑马灯显示流水灯显示按键计数显示控制CPU功耗发光二极管闪烁显示蜂鸣器发音秒表脉冲计数看门狗定时器的应用软件抗干扰实例数码管扫描显示多个数码管的混合显示按键编号显示显示数据加减1调整多功能键处理实例连击键处理实例双机通信单片机与PC机通信电量数据的采集非电量数据的r